Things to do near
Moss Bluff, Louisiana

  • Lafayette Science Museum - Located in Lafayette, LA, this museum offers interactive exhibits and planetarium shows that are perfect for families and science enthusiasts.

  • Sam Houston Jones State Park - Just a short drive from Moss Bluff, this park features hiking trails, picnic areas, and opportunities for bird watching amidst beautiful natural scenery.

  • Lake Charles Civic Center - Situated in Lake Charles, LA, the civic center hosts a variety of events including concerts and festivals throughout the year.

  • Creole Nature Trail Adventure Point - Located near Sulphur, LA, this interactive visitor center provides insights into the local wildlife and culture of Louisiana's Outback.

  • Historic City Hall Arts & Cultural Center - In Lake Charles, this cultural hub showcases rotating art exhibitions and historical displays within a beautifully restored historic building.

  • Prien Lake Park - A popular spot in Lake Charles offering walking paths along the lakefront with playgrounds and picnic facilities for family outings.

  • Imperial Calcasieu Museum - This museum in Lake Charles features regional art collections as well as historical artifacts that tell the story of Southwest Louisiana.
